County Fermanagh, often referred to as Ireland's Lake District, with upper and lower Lough Erne, is now linked to the River Shannon and its waterways via the Shannon-Erne Waterway canal, making it the longest navigable inland waterway in Europe.
The main town of Fermanagh is Enniskillen. |
